When and where to buy tickets for Pakistan matches at the ICC Cricket World Cup 2023?
Pakistan will kick-of their ICC Cricket World Cup 2023 campaign on 6th October in Hyderabad.
The 2023 men’s ODI World Cup will begin on October 5 in Ahmedabad, and matches will be held across ten venues, and culminate in the final – also in Ahmedabad – on November 19. The semi-finals will be held in Mumbai and Kolkata on November 15 and 16.
The 45 league matches and the three knockouts will be played in Ahmedabad, Bengaluru, Chennai, Delhi, Dharamsala, Hyderabad, Kolkata, Lucknow, Mumbai, and Pune over a span of 46 days. The two semi-finals and the final will all have reserve days.
Finally, Pakistan have received the green signal from their government to travel to India for the upcoming ICC World Cup 2023. After months of negotiations, threats and whatnot, the Babar Azam-led side will travel to their neighboring country for the first time since 2016.
The last time Pakistan came to India was for the 2016 T20 World Cup and last time they played any bilateral game in India was in 2012-13 series. Since then, both the teams have only played in ICC and ACC events.
The last World Cup tournament in 2019 was not a good one for the Pakistan team, as they failed to qualify for the semi-final, which led to Babar Azam taking over the captaincy and since then, they have a decent record in the 50-over format.
They reached the semi-final of the T20 World Cup in 2021 and the final of the 2022 T20 World Cup under Babar’s captaincy.
Men in Green have won the World Cup once in 1992 under Imran Khan and since then made it into the knockout stages in the 1996 World Cup, losing to India in the quarterfinals. Played in the final of the 1999 World Cup in England, losing to Australia, and then played in the semi-final in the 2011 World Cup, losing to India in Mohali.
Pakistan’s Complete Schedule for ICC Cricket World Cup 2023:
Five locations will host Pakistan’s league stage games: Hyderabad, Chennai, Ahmedabad, Bengaluru, and Kolkata. Their last league game will take place against England on November 12 at Kolkata’s Eden Gardens.
On October 14, they will play India in the biggest cricket stadium in the world, located in Ahmedabad.
Pakistan have already requested a change in the venues for their matches against Australia and Afghanistan. They decided against playing Afghanistan in Chennai due to the opponent’s potent team of spin bowlers. They expressed a desire to play in Chennai against Australia and Bangalore against Afghanistan.
However, the ICC rejected their plea, therefore they will play Australia on a batting-friendly Australian field and Afghanistan on a spin-friendly Chennai pitch.
In case, Pakistan reach the semi-final stage of the ICC World Cup 2023, they will play their knockout match in Eden Gardens, Kolkata.
Two of their matches were rescheduled after BCCI and ICC revised the schedule as now they will play Sri Lanka on October 10 instead of October 12 and will now play India on October 14 instead of October 15, but the venue remains the same.
When and Where to buy Pakistan cricket team’s game tickets?
The process for fans to obtain tickets to watch their teams compete in the mega-cricket event was made public by the International Cricket Council. According to the ICC, ticket registration for fans will begin on August 15 and the sale will begin on August 25.
Beginning on August 25, fans can purchase tickets for non-India warm-up games and non-India event games. The ticket sales for India’s exhibition games will start on August 30. The ICC will soon make known where spectators may purchase tickets.
When to buy Pakistan cricket team’s game tickets?
1. Pakistan vs Netherlands, October 6, Hyderabad – Tickets from August 25
2. Pakistan vs Sri Lanka, October 10. Hyderabad – Tickets from August 25
3. Pakistan vs India, October 14, Ahmedabad – Tickets from August 31
4. Pakistan vs Australia, October 20, Bengaluru – Tickets from August 25
5. Pakistan vs Afghanistan, October 23, Chennai – Tickets from August 25
6. Pakistan vs South Africa, October 27, Chennai – Tickets from August 25
7. Pakistan vs Bangladesh, October 31, Kolkata – Tickets from August 25
8. Pakistan vs New Zealand, November 4, Bengaluru – Tickets from August 25
9. Pakistan vs England, November 11, Kolkata – Tickets from August 25
